How they compare

Macao currently reports 6.2% against 6.1% in Kazakhstan, a difference of 0.1%.

The two have swapped places 18 times across 39 shared years of data; in 1986 it was Macao ahead.

Kazakhstan ranks 29th and Macao ranks 28th of 216 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Kazakhstan averaged higher in 2 and Macao in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Kazakhstan Macao Difference Ahead
1980s 1.6% 13.9% 12.3% Macao
1990s -7.1% 5.4% 12.4% Macao
2000s 3.8% 4.2% 0.4% Macao
2010s 3.8% 3.5% 0.3% Kazakhstan
2020s 2.1% -0.2% 2.3% Kazakhstan

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
